Student’s Guide to Mentorship (Arch Ready Fall 2026)
Date: October 28, 2026
Time: 12:00 pm until 1:00 pm
Location: Online Via Handshake
What is mentoring? How do I find a mentor? How is a mentor beneficial to me? These might be a few questions you ask yourself when considering joining the UGA Mentor Program. This panel of UGA students will share their experiences to provide guidance around navigating mentoring relationships and explain effective practices to help you leverage mentorship to achieve your personal and professional goals.
In this workshop you will:
- Describe what the UGA Mentor Program is and operate the UGA Mentor Program platform
- Identify at least two mentoring resources and how they can be used in a mentoring relationship
- Write at least two mentorship expectations or intended goals for your future mentoring relationship
